By signing this petition I call upon Powys County Council to halt the nonsensical proposal to turn off 67% (2 out of 3) of the counties streetlights and honour there aim in improving the quality of life for those that live in Powys. Powys County Council has an estimated 14,006 street lighting columns and proposes to pull the fuse on an estimated 7,500 street lighting columns in the defined non-core areas of the County. This whole proposal is driven by the fact that although Powys County Council agreed to find a £50,000 saving in street lighting energy costâs through the introduction of part night lighting (12.00 Midnight â 05.30AM) the Council is now faced with increased energy costs of 36% (£175,000) for street lighting meaning a total saving of £225,000 needs to be found Powys County Council has a net budget of £223m for 2008/09 and £47.7m (21%) is collected from Council Tax paid by the residents of Powys and we ask that the £225,000 that needs to be saved is done in another way with out the reduction of street lighting. http://www.powys.gov.uk/uploads/media/Council_Tax_Leaflet_en.pdf
